Output efed2c35182f02550f37e6aecafd1bd1ebbe1a96af8d6807013b3914aec18fb9:0

value
6600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cb44fc4886b1fcd949af2368b2a85e6c53aac6a OP_EQUAL
address
3BbnuXix9N782vbccKMC8U77KPudjdic9X
transaction
efed2c35182f02550f37e6aecafd1bd1ebbe1a96af8d6807013b3914aec18fb9
spent
true